When it comes to supervised agricultural experiences advisors and myself frequently use the terms “traditional” and “non-traditional”. Traditional usually refers to a student raising animals, breeding animals and selling offspring. Although, as an advisor recently pointed out to me, this is becoming more “non-traditional.”
Today’s guest is raising, breeding and selling animals but I would consider her SAE pretty “non-traditional” in spite of this. Mary Elias found a passion for snakes, and now she is breeding and preparing to sell their offspring. She has already contacted retailers and received interest all around her state of California.
Currently Mary is raising ball pythons, corn snakes and Burmese pythons. Her Burmese is named “Reesy” and in just over 1 year she has grown from 2 feet long to 13 feet long with a diameter the size of an average person’s thigh.
Mary feeds Reesy chickens and rabbits. What an absolutely fascinating project. Wait until you hear her talk about snakes. She really knows her stuff!
